Willow Park History

In March 1996, the Town of Halton Hills' Environmental Advisory Committee (TEAC) hosted a workshop with respect to "Green Communities". Inspired by the efforts presented by the City of Peterborough at a Round Table Discussion, the Committee considered the potential for a similar effort in Halton Hills. The old Willow RV Park in Norval was deemed to provide a suitable site to develop the proposed facility. Town staff and Council, as well as CVC staff, were approached with the idea and the project's planning was initiated. TEAC proceeded with an effort to plan and create an Ecology Centre, together with the Town's Park and Recreation Department and with the Credit Valley Conservation (CVC).

Since the start of the park many features have been added so the public can better enjoy the area. Such as:

Gardens
Wetland with viewing platform
Bridge over Silver Creek
Interpretive Pavillion
Kiosk
Weather Station
Tree Trail
Benches
Wildlife homes and houses
